Let&#39;s delve into its features.</p><p>This motor operates at a rated voltage of 400 V and a current of 2.3 A, making it suitable for standard industrial power setups in Australia. With a frequency rating of 50 Hz, it aligns perfectly with local electrical standards.</p><p>The motor&#39;s degree of protection is IP55, indicating strong resistance against dust ingress and water jets from any direction—ideal for environments where exposure to such elements is common. Its mounting versatility includes both foot and large flange options, providing flexibility in installation according to your structural needs.</p><p>In terms of dimensions, this motor measures 170 mm in width, 217 mm in height, and has a depth of 331.5 mm. Weighing in at 19 kg, it&#39;s relatively easy to handle during installation or maintenance tasks.</p><p>Aesthetically finished in Munsell Blue, the motor not only performs well but also meets visual preferences often required by industry standards. It can operate efficiently within an ambient temperature up to 40&#176;C without compromising its performance.</p><p>With a rated power output of 1.1 kW and constructed from durable aluminium material, this motor ensures energy efficiency while maintaining strength and resilience under continuous operation conditions.</p><p>The frame size adheres to IEC standards at size 90 which facilitates compatibility with other equipment adhering to international norms.
